Dobalapal, India
Jagamohanpur-Telkoi Rd
N/A
Nice coumunication way of keonjhar to Dhenkanal
like
For something work
Nice
there is no shop just from the pan shop and a small hotel .Let me put this bus stand very useless
Day time buses available
Nic
Deli
The best companies in the category 'Deli'